Output 626324da205fd51864ea35b5a49dbf10475240521e3ae60e6955e065d71e6c68:0

value
23956555
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bae779f841fb60f146c7dffb58ba7beddb5fc702c66ecad01e34c2dbfa4f6bd9
address
bc1phtnhn7zplds0z3k8mla43wnmahd4l3czcehv45q7xnpdh7j0d0vsh4lzf8
transaction
626324da205fd51864ea35b5a49dbf10475240521e3ae60e6955e065d71e6c68